by tama » 24 Mar 2010, 22:13
Hm, sinon y a l'instruction Return qui existe pour revenir dans ton programme d'où tu l'as quitté

prgmMAIN
[font=Courier New]
ClrHome
0-I
Disp "Programme principal"
Disp "I=",I
prgmSUB
Disp "Retour au programme principal"
Disp "I=",I
[/font]
prgmSUB
[font=Courier New]
42-I
Disp "Sous-programme"
Disp "I=",I
Return
[/font]
Devrait afficher (si je ne dis pas de bêtises) (aux majuscules/minuscules près)
Programme principal
I=
0
Sous-programme
I=
42
Retour au programme principal
I=
42
Sinon, c'est une bonne chose en général de séparer les programmes (programmation modulaire toussa ... en gros pour éviter de devoir tout changer quand tu veux faire une petite modification, ça marche surtout pour les langages compilés pour éviter de tout recompiler à chaque modification) mais pour un petit programme comme celui-là ce n'est pas la peine, tu peux tout regrouper
Have fun

`echo "ZWNobyAncm0gLXJmIC4gaGFoYWhhIDpEJwo=" | base64 -d`
Pas de support par MP, merci.